Slamming is the technical word for having your long distance service switched without your permission. If you have been slammed contact The Public Utilities Commission of Ohio, Public Interest Center, 180 East Broad Street, Columbus OH 43215-3793. You may also report it by calling them at 1- (800) 686-7826

Telecommunications Terms

Telephony

The word used to describe the science of transmitting voice over a telecommunications network.

TTY

A type of machine that allows people with hearing or speech disabilities to communicate over the phone using a keyboard and a viewing screen. It is sometimes called a TDD.
